Responsibilities

  • Lead technical strategy for benchmarking and performance optimization at inference-engine and GPU-kernel layers.
  • Optimize attention layers, memory and precision management, and parallelization across multi-node GPU clusters.
  • Tune AITER, composable kernel, assembly, FP8, and BF16 workloads for AMD MI355X GPUs.
  • Identify kernel-fusion opportunities for Transformer layers such as FlashAttention and RMS Norm.
  • Tune expert-gateway router kernels for mixture-of-experts models including Qwen3-235B, DeepSeek V3, and GLM-5.
  • Advise on modern NVIDIA and AMD GPU hardware procurement and software integration.
  • Develop and deploy quantization techniques using FP8, INT8, and experimental FP4.
  • Provide technical leadership through code and design reviews without direct people-management responsibilities.
  • Partner with Product Management and Technical Program Managers to turn hardware capabilities into shippable product features.
  • Participate in GPU infrastructure and model-performance communities and contribute to open-source AI.

Requirements

  • 5+ years of experience in high-performance computing or AI infrastructure.
  • Proven experience solving compute-utilization and memory-bandwidth bottlenecks.
  • Deep familiarity with generative AI, including LLM, VLM, LMM, and major model-family architectures.
  • Hands-on experience with attention-layer optimization and parallelization across distributed GPU environments.
  • Comprehensive understanding of NVIDIA and AMD GPU architectures and their software ecosystems.
  • Extensive experience integrating, building with, and contributing to open-source software.
  • Excellent system design skills involving low-level GPU programming, optimization, memory access patterns, and parallel execution.
  • Experience acting as a technical lead and driving design and delivery through cross-functional alignment.
  • Deep understanding of GPU architectures, including SMs, warp scheduling, and Tensor Cores.
  • Expert-level Triton or CUDA experience; Triton compiler contributions or custom CUDA kernels for major LLMs are valued.
